1.Distribution of pupil diameter and its association with myopia in school age children
Chinese Journal of School Health 2025;46(8):1194-1197
Objective:
To investigate the distribution of pupil diameter and its association with myopia in school age children, providing ideas into the mechanisms of the role of pupil diameter in the onset and development of myopia.
Methods:
Adopting a combination of stratified cluster random sampling and convenience sampling method, 3 839 children from six schools in Shandong Province were included in September 2021. Pupil diameters distribution was analyzed by age, sex, and myopic status. Pearson correlation analysis was used to assess the relationship between pupil diameter and cycloplegic spherical equivalent (SE), as well as axial length (AL) and other variables. Propensity score matching (PSM) was applied to match myopic and non myopic children at a 1∶1 ratio based on age and sex. A generalized linear model (GLM) was constructed with pupil diameter as the dependent variable to identify independent factors influencing pupil size and its association with myopia.
Results:
The mean pupil diameter of school age children was (5.77±0.80)mm. Pupil diameter exhibited a significant increasing trend with age ( F =49.34, P trend < 0.01). Myopic children had a significantly larger mean pupil diameter [(6.10±0.73)mm] compared to non myopic children [(5.62±0.79)mm] with a statistically significant difference( t=18.10, P <0.01). Multivariable GLM analysis, adjusted for age, amplitude of accommodation, and uncorrected visual acuity, revealed a negative correlation between pupil diameter and cycloplegic SE (before PSM: β =-0.089, after PSM: β =-0.063, both P <0.01).
Conclusions
Myopic school age children exhibite larger pupil diameters than their non myopic counterparts. Pupil diameter may serve as a potential indicator for monitoring myopia development in school age children.
2.Virus spectrum and epidemic characteristics of hospitalized children with acute respiratory tract infections in Guilin area, 2021 to 2022
Renhe ZHU ; Hu LONG ; Rundong CAO ; Lulu WANG ; Juan SONG ; Qinqin SONG ; Guoyong MEI ; Zhiqiang XIA ; Jun HAN ; Chen GAO
Chinese Journal of Experimental and Clinical Virology 2024;38(1):43-48
Objective:To understand the composition of respiratory virus spectrum in hospitalized children with acute respiratory infections in Guilin City from 2021 to 2022, and to explore the epidemic characteristics of different respiratory viruses.Methods:Information of a total of 638 hospitalized children with acute respiratory infections (ARI) syndrome under the age of 14 years in Guilin city, Guangxi from September 2021 to October 2022 was collected as research data. The collected pharyngeal swabs from pediatric patients were subjected to real-time fluorescence reverse transcription polymerase chain reaction for nucleic acid testing, screening for 15 common respiratory viruses, and analyzing the virus spectrum characteristics of hospitalized pediatric patients with acute respiratory infections.Results:Among the 638 specimens, 365 were tested positive for at least one virus, with a positive rate of 57.21% (365/638). The detection rate for two or more viruses was 12.85% (82/638). There were 12 types of viruses detected, and the difference in virus detection rates among different seasons was statistically significant (P<0.002). The virus positive detection rate of samples from different age groups was the highest in the 0-2-year old group (40.66%), followed by the 3-5-year old group (34.80%) and the 6-year and older group (24.54%).Conclusions:During the period from September 2021 to October 2022, all 12 respiratory viruses were prevalent in Guilin area, with obvious summer peak as characteristics. It is suggested that corresponding prevention and control measures should be focused on pathogens that may cause acute respiratory infections in children during the local summer to prevent and control the spread and prevalence of respiratory infections.
3.Clinical guidelines for the diagnosis and treatment of osteoporotic thoracolumbar vertebral fracture with kyphotic deformity in the elderly (version 2024)
Jian CHEN ; Qingqing LI ; Jun GU ; Zhiyi HU ; Shujie ZHAO ; Zhenfei HUANG ; Tao JIANG ; Wei ZHOU ; Xiaojian CAO ; Yongxin REN ; Weihua CAI ; Lipeng YU ; Tao SUI ; Qian WANG ; Pengyu TANG ; Mengyuan WU ; Weihu MA ; Xuhua LU ; Hongjian LIU ; Zhongmin ZHANG ; Xiaozhong ZHOU ; Baorong HE ; Kainan LI ; Tengbo YU ; Xiaodong GUO ; Yongxiang WANG ; Yong HAI ; Jiangang SHI ; Baoshan XU ; Weishi LI ; Jinglong YAN ; Guangzhi NING ; Yongfei GUO ; Zhijun QIAO ; Feng ZHANG ; Fubing WANG ; Fuyang CHEN ; Yan JIA ; Xiaohua ZHOU ; Yuhui PENG ; Jin FAN ; Guoyong YIN
Chinese Journal of Trauma 2024;40(11):961-973
The incidence of osteoporotic thoracolumbar vertebral fracture (OTLVF) in the elderly is gradually increasing. The kyphotic deformity caused by various factors has become an important characteristic of OTLVF and has received increasing attention. Its clinical manifestations include pain, delayed nerve damage, sagittal imbalance, etc. Currently, the definition and diagnosis of OTLVF with kyphotic deformity in the elderly are still unclear. Although there are many treatment options, they are controversial. Existing guidelines or consensuses pay little attention to this type of fracture with kyphotic deformity. To this end, the Lumbar Education Working Group of the Spine Branch of the Chinese Medicine Education Association and Editorial Committee of Chinese Journal of Trauma organized the experts in the relevant fields to jointly develop Clinical guidelines for the diagnosis and treatment of osteoporotic thoracolumbar vertebral fractures with kyphotic deformity in the elderly ( version 2024), based on evidence-based medical advancements and the principles of scientificity, practicality, and advanced nature, which provided 18 recommendations to standardize the clinical diagnosis and treatment.
4.Analyzing the characteristics and influencing factors of high frequency hearing loss among noise-exposed workers in an urban rail transit enterprise
Taihua LONG ; Bin XIAO ; Aichu YANG ; Jianyu GUO ; Minghui XIAO ; Guoyong XU ; Lichun ZHAN ; Shijie HU
China Occupational Medicine 2023;50(6):671-676
{L-End}Objective To analyze the characteristics of hearing loss and the influencing factors of high-frequency hearing loss (HFHL) among noise-exposed workers in an urban rail transit enterprise over five consecutive years. {L-End}Methods A total of 1 268 noise-exposed workers, who exposed to the average noise intensity of <85.0 dB(A), in an urban rail transit enterprise was selected as the research subjects using a judgment sampling method. The pure-tone audiometry results from 2019 to 2023 were collected to analyze the result of hearing loss. The influencing factors of HFHL (average hearing threshold ≥40.0 dB at high frequencies in both ears) were analyzed using the generalized estimating equations (GEE). {L-End}Results The detection rates of threshold elevations at frequencies of 0.5-6.0 kHz increased with increasing frequency from 2019 to 2023 (all P<0.01), with the highest detection rate at 6.0 kHz. The detection rate of speech frequency hearing loss (hearing threshold weighted value≥26.0 dB in the better ear) was 0.1%, 0.0%, 0.4%, 0.2%, and 0.2%, respectively. The detection rate of HFHL from 2019 to 2023 was 2.4%, 2.8%, 2.8%, 2.1%, and 2.8%, respectively. The GEE analysis results showed that the risk of HFHL of the workers in 2022 and 2023 was lower than that in 2019 (all P<0.01), with the odds ratios and 95% confidence intervals [OR (95%CI)] of 0.57 (0.41-0.81) and 0.65 (0.48-0.87), respectively. The risk of HFHL was higher among vehicle maintenance worker than train drivers (P<0.05), with OR (95%CI) of 2.37 (1.18-4.77). The risk of HFHL increased with age and length of service among the workers (all P<0.05), with the OR (95%CI) of 2.05 (1.22-3.46) and 1.69 (1.12-2.54), respectively. No interaction was found between type of job and age, type of job and length of service, or age and length of service in the risk of HFHL among the research subjects(all P<0.05). {L-End}Conclusion Noise exposure below the national occupational exposure limits can lead to hearing loss in noise-exposed workers of urban rail transit enterprises, possibly affecting the hearing threshold at 6.0 kHz first. The influencing factors for HFHL in workers of rail transit are age, length of service, and type of job. There is a dose-effect relationship with age and length of service.
5.Clinical efficacy and outcome analysis of early abdominal paracentesis drainage for treating patients with severe acute pancreatitis
Jingjing ZHENG ; Hui XIE ; Ge YU ; Shanshan JIN ; Wenjie HUANG ; Guoyong HU ; Ruilan WANG
Chinese Journal of Pancreatology 2023;23(2):114-119
Objective:To analyse the clinical efficacy and outcome of early abdominal paracentesis drainage (APD) in the treatment of severe acute pancreatitis (SAP).Methods:The clinical data of 107 SAP patients with massive abdominal fluid in Shanghai General People Hospital from May 2017 to December 2021 were collected and analyzed. Patients were divided into APD group ( n=56) and NO-APD group ( n=51) according to whether they underwent APD or not within 3 days after admission. The APD group was then divided into abdominal compartment syndrome (ACS) subgroup ( n=29) and NO-ACS subgroup ( n=27) according to whether ACS had occurred or not at the time of puncture. Patients' general data, the duration of systemic inflammatory response (SIRS), length of ICU stay, the trends of intra-abdominal pressure and inflammatory indicators (white blood cell count and the content of C-reactive protein) within 1-3 days after admission, incidence of infection complication, step-up therapy, discharge or death were recorded. Results:The intra-abdominal pressure were 18.6±5.6mmHg , 13.7±4.2mmHg (1 mmHg=0.133 kpa) in APD group and NO-APD group, respectively. The intra-abdominal pressure of APD group was significantly higher than that of NO-APD group, and the difference was statistically significant ( P=0.000). Compared with NO-APD group, the duration of SIRS was significantly shortened in APD group [3(2, 4) days vs 4(3, 6) days, P=0.029]. On day 1, 2 and 3 after admission, the intra-abdominal pressure was 18.6±5.6 mmHg, 16.4±4.7 mmHg and 13.5±3.9 mmHg in APD group, and was 13.7±4.2 mmHg, 12.3±3.6 mmHg and 11.0±2.6 mmHg in NO-APD group, respectively. The intra-abdominal pressure of the APD group dropped faster than the NO-APD group ( P=0.004). The white blood cell count was (14.8±4.8), (10.5±4.5) and (9.0±3.8)×10 9/L in APD group, and was (14.2±5.4), (12.3±7.3), (11.7±5.3)×10 9/L in NO-APD group, respectively. Compared with the NO-APD group, the decrease rate of white blood cell count was faster in APD group ( P=0.006). The C-reactive protein content was (153.6±47.1), (150.4±10.5) and (108.8±49.4)mg/L in APD group, and were (174.8±31.1), (191.6±29.4) and (186.8±45.5)mg/L in NO-APD group . The content of C-reactive protein in APD group decreased significantly, while that in NO-APD group did not decrease. There was a significant difference between the two groups ( P=0.009). In the subgroup comparisons, the duration of SIRS in the ACS subgroup was significant longer than that in the NO-ACS subgroup [4(3, 5) days vs 2(1, 3)days, P=0.000]. Compared between the two groups and two subgroups respectively, there were no statistically significant differences on length of ICU stay, infection complication rate, advanced treatment rate and mortality. Conclusions:For SAP patients with abdominal fluid, APD in the early stage could shorten the duration of SIRS, decrease intra-abdominal pressure rapidly, improve inflammatory indicators, but could not improve the clinical outcome.
6.Molecular mechanism of topoisomerase I inhibitor in protecting against experimental acute pancreatitis in mice
Jingpiao BAO ; Bin LI ; Jianghong WU ; Zengkai WU ; Jie SHEN ; Pengli SONG ; Qi PENG ; Guoyong HU
Chinese Journal of Pancreatology 2022;22(2):107-112
Objective:To investigate the protective mechanism of topoisomerase I inhibitor on pancreatic acinar cells and lung during acute pancreatitis (AP) in mice.Methods:Eighteen Balb/C male mice were randomly divided into three groups using random number method: control group, AP group and CPT+ AP group. AP model was established by intraperitoneal injection of caerulein and lipopolysaccharide. CPT+ AP group received intraperitoneal injection of camptothecin (CPT, 50 mg/kg) before AP induction. Mice in control group were intraperitoneal injected with an equal volume of normal saline. The pathological examinations of pancreas and lung tissue were analyzed. The serum levels of amylase and lipase were detected by enzyme linked immunosorbent assay (ELISA) and the mRNA expression of IL-1 and IL-6 were analyzed by reverse transcription-polymerase chain reaction (RT-PCR); the infiltration of CD 45+ cells in pancreas and lung tissue as well as the expression of phosphorylated mixed lineage kinase domain-like protein(MLKL) in pancreas were detected by immunohistochemistry; the apoptosis index of pancreatic cells was analyzed by TUNEL assay. Results:The pathological scores of pancreas and lung tissue, serum levels of amylase and lipase in CPT+ AP group were [(2.30±0.31), (2.29±0.34), (1742.33±183.51)U/L and (46.90±2.17)U/L], which were significantly lower than those in AP group [(5.06±0.88), (3.40±0.09), (2385.33±383.10)U/L and (69.13±9.76)U/L]; the mRNA expression of IL-1 and IL-6 in pancreatic tissue were 95.79±48.11, 255.50±213.32, which were also remarkably lower than those in AP group (212.35±80.61, 1006.80±509.06); the infiltration of CD 45+ inflammatory cells in pancreas and lung were (14.25±5.32, 29.20±4.44)/high power field, which were notably lower than those in AP group (59.83±13.67, 58.25±5.91)/high power field; the apoptosis index of pancreatic cells was significantly higher than that in AP group [(3.64±1.16)% vs (1.92±0.29)%]; the histochemistry score of phosphorylated MLKL protein in pancreatic tissue was significantly lower than that in AP group (1.75±0.20 vs 4.53±1.28), and the differences were statistically significant (all P value <0.05). Conclusions:Topoisomerase I inhibitor could induce the apoptosis of pancreatic acinar cells and inhibit the death mode of necrotic pancreatic acinar cells during AP remodeling, thus reducing pancreatic local injury and AP-associated lung injury.
7.Clinical guideline for spinal reconstruction of osteoporotic thoracolumbar fracture in elderly patients (version 2022)
Tao SUI ; Jian CHEN ; Zhenfei HUANG ; Zhiyi HU ; Weihua CAI ; Lipeng YU ; Xiaojian CAO ; Wei ZHOU ; Qingqing LI ; Jin FAN ; Qian WANG ; Pengyu TANG ; Shujie ZHAO ; Lin CHEN ; Zhiming CUI ; Wenyuan DING ; Shiqing FENG ; Xinmin FENG ; Yanzheng GAO ; Baorong HE ; Jianzhong HUO ; Haijun LI ; Jun LIU ; Fei LUO ; Chao MA ; Zhijun QIAO ; Qiang WANG ; Shouguo WANG ; Xiaotao WU ; Nanwei XU ; Jinglong YAN ; Zhaoming YE ; Feng YUAN ; Jishan YUAN ; Jie ZHAO ; Xiaozhong ZHOU ; Mengyuan WU ; Yongxin REN ; Guoyong YIN
Chinese Journal of Trauma 2022;38(12):1057-1066
Osteoporotic thoracolumbar fracture in the elderly will seriously reduce their quality of life and life expectancy. For osteoporotic thoracolumbar fracture in the elderly, spinal reconstruction is necessary, which should comprehensively consider factors such as the physical condition, fracture type, clinical characteristics and osteoporosis degree. While there lacks relevant clinical norms or guidelines on selection of spinal reconstruction strategies. In order to standardize the concept of spinal reconstruction for osteoporotic thoracolumbar fracture in the elderly, based on the principles of scientificity, practicality and progressiveness, the authors formulated the Clinical guideline for spinal reconstruction of osteoporotic thoracolumbar fracture in elderly patients ( version 2022), in which suggestions based on evidence of evidence-based medicine were put forward upon 10 important issues related to the fracture classification, non-operative treatment strategies and surgical treatment strategies in spinal reconstruction after osteoporosis thoracolumbar fracture in the elderly, hoping to provide a reference for clinical treatment.
8. Evaluating the occupational exposure to hand-transmitted vibration in golf ball head grinding positions
Hansheng LIN ; Danying ZHANG ; Maosheng YAN ; Bin XIAO ; Hua YAN ; Guoyong XU ; Xiao ZHANG ; Xinan WU ; Pei HU ; Qingsong CHEN
China Occupational Medicine 2019;46(03):286-291
OBJECTIVE: To evaluate the exposure status of hand-transmitted vibration(HTV)in golf ball head grinding workers.METHODS: The golf ball head grinding positions in a sports equipment factory were selected as the research subjects by the judgement sampling method.The HTV exposure level of the workers in 66 grinding positions was measured,the key control points for HTV hazards were identified,and the damage of HTV was classified.RESULTS: The median(M)of 4 hours energy equivalent frequency-weighted acceleration to vibration[a_(hw(4))]of grinding positions in this sports equipment factory was 4.21 m/s~2,and the a_(hw(4)) over standard rate was 50.0%(33/66).The a_(hw(4)) of rough grinding positions was higher than that of fine grinding positions(M:5.50 v.s 3.94 m/s~2,P<0.05).In both rough grinding positions and fine grinding positions,the a_(hw(4)) of different ball head grinding types from high to low were hollow titanium alloy ball heads, hollow stainless steel ball heads,and solid stainless steel ball heads(rough grinding positions M:7.41 vs4.43 vs 3.11 m/s~2,P<0.01; fine grinding p ositions M:5.24 vs 4.21 vs 2.93 m/s~2,P<0.01).For the hollow titanium alloy ball head grinding positions,the a_(hw(4)) of rough grinding was higher than that of fine grinding(M:7.47 vs 5.24 m/s~2,P<0.01).Rough grinding positions,especially hollow stainless steel ball heads and hollow titanium alloy ball head grinding positions were key control points for HTV hazards.In the 66 grinding positions,the HTV hazards were classified as grade 0,Ⅰ,Ⅱ,and Ⅲ in the grinding positions accounted for 3.0%,47.0%,40.9%,and 9.1%,respectively,and those with grade Ⅱ and above were 50.0%(33/66). CONCLUSION: The exposure level of HTV in golf ball head grinding workers is high,with a trend of exceeding the standard.The golf ball head grinding workers have a high occupational health risk.

10.Mid-term results of fixation of coronoid fractures via modified anterior elbow neurovascular interval approach
Ming XIANG ; Guoyong YANG ; Xiaochuan HU ; Hang CHEN ; Yiping LI
Chinese Journal of Orthopaedics 2018;38(1):8-15
Objective To explore the efficacy and complication prevention of operative fixation of coronoid fractures via neurovascular interval of anterior elbow approach.Methods From March 2006 to September 2009,data of 21 patients with coronoid process fractures associated with complex elbow dislocation who were treated via neurovascular interval of anterior elbow approach in my ward were retrospectively analyzed.There were 14 males and 7 females.The mean age of the patients was 31.6 years (range,18-52 years).Injury was caused by walk falling in 10 cases,falling from standing-height in 3 cases and sports events in 8 cases;7 patients were left side and 14 patients were right side,including 16 prominent sides and 5 non-prominent sides.There were 3 type Ⅰa,3 type Ⅱa,8 type Ⅱb,4 type Ⅱc,3 type Ⅲa coronoid process fractures according to the O'Driscoll's classification.Pre-operative 3D-CT scans were conducted to clarify if there were subluxations or sign of instabilities in elbows.Operative fixation of coronoid process fractures with cannulated screws and/or mini plates and/or suture anchors were carried out via the anterior interval between humeral vessels and median nerve,and then lateral collateral ligaments were repaired if instability still existed.Results The average operation time was 72 min,and the follow-up time was 52-74 months.Only 1 case of type Ⅰa fracture got nonunion because of early postoperative activities from the first day after the operation and the elbow was fixed at 0 degree of extension with brace.At the latest follow-up,in suture anchor fixation group (3 cases),the average VAS was 1.8±0.5,Broberg-Morrey score 90.2±6.6,extension deficiency 11.2°±3.6°,flexion 133.4°±8.8°,and the excellent-good-rate was 66.7% (2 cases excellent and 1 fair).In the screw-fixation group (10 cases),the average VAS was 1.6±0.8,Broberg-Morrey score 89.2±6.6,extension deficiency 15.2°±4.6°,flexion 130.8°±10.8°,and the excellent-good-rate was 90% (6 cases excellent,3 good,and 1 fair).In the mini plate fixation group (8 cases),the average VAS score was 1.6±0.7,Broberg-Morrey score 88.6±6.7,extension deficiency 11.8°±5.6°,flexion 134.2°±8.6°,and the excellent-good-rate was 87.5% (4 cases excellent,3 good,and 1 fair).In the lateral ligament repaired group (14 cases),the average VAS was 1.3±0.9,Broberg-Morrey score 91.5±6.3,extension deficiency 10.2°±3.4°,flexion 135.2°±4.2°,and the excellent-good-rate was 100% (8 cases excellent,6 good).In the lateral ligament non-repaired group (7 cases),the average VAS was 2.2± 1.6,Broberg-Morrey score 80.2± 13.8,extension deficiency 13.6°±4.4°,flexion 126.6°±4.0°,and the excellent-good-rate was 71.4% (3 cases excellent,2 good,1 fair).There were 5 cases which had early osteoarthritis changes in the elbow joint in 3 years' follow-up,with the incidence rate 23.8% (5/21),and the incidence of mid-term osteoarthritis in the 5 and 7 years after operation was 4.8% (1/21).Conclusion Operative fixation of coronoid fractures with suture anchor and/or cannulated screw and/or mini plate via neurovascular interval of anterior elbow approach was confirmed to be efficient and safe.Lateral collateral ligaments should be repaired if the elbow is unstable.
